The Church of Archangel Michael in Syuksym

The stone temple, consisting of two floors, was built by the parishioners in 1831. It houses two altars: on the lower floor, in honor of the Archangel Michael, and on the upper floor, in honor of the Smolensk Icon of the Mother of God.

After its closure in the 1930s, the church underwent numerous reconstructions. During different periods, various institutions were housed in the building, and at one time, a telephone station was located in the altar area. In the 1970s, by order of the authorities, many structures in the village were built by teams of Armenian builders, and the walls of the temple were covered with a concrete "coat," giving it a grim appearance.
